Concrete raising services involve elevating s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their original position. This process typically uses specialized materials, such as polyurethane foam, to lift the affected areas without the need for extensive demolition or replacement. The procedure is designed to quickly and effectively re-level driveways, sidewalks, patios, and other flat concrete surfaces, helping to improve their appearance and functionality.

One of the primary issues addressed by concrete raising is uneven or cracked surfaces that can pose safety hazards or cause inconvenience. Sunken concrete can create tripping risks, hinder proper drainage, and lead to further structural problems if left unaddressed. By raising and leveling the concrete, service providers can help prevent accidents, reduce the likelihood of additional damage, and restore the surface’s stability.

Concrete raising is commonly utilized on residential properties, such as driveways, walkways, and patios, where uneven surfaces can impact daily activities and curb appeal. It is also frequently used on commercial properties, including parking lots and storefront entrances, where a smooth, level surface is essential for safety and accessibility. Additionally, property managers and municipalities may employ this service to maintain public walkways and other communal areas.

The process offers a minimally invasive alternative to replacing entire concrete slabs, making it a popular choice for property owners seeking a cost-effective, efficient solution. Cost Range for Concrete Raising - The typical cost for concrete raising services varies based on the size and extent of the repair, generally falling between $500 and $2,000. Smaller projects, such as a single slab, may be closer to $500, while larger areas can approach $2,000 or more.

Factors Affecting Pricing - Factors like the severity of the settling, accessibility, and location influence the overall cost. For example, uneven driveways in Clarkston, MI, might cost around $1,200 on average, but complex jobs could be higher.

Average Cost per Square Foot - Many service providers charge approximately $3 to $6 per square foot for concrete lifting. A typical residential driveway repair might cover 300 square feet, with costs ranging from $900 to $1,800.

What is concrete raising? Concrete raising involves lifting and leveling s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their original position and appearance.

How do professionals raise concrete? Local service providers typically use specialized foam or mudjacking techniques to lift and stabilize the concrete.

Is concrete raising a suitable solution for all cracks? Concrete raising is effective for certain types of cracks and settling issues,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ine suitability.

How long does the concrete raising process take? The process usually can be completed within a few hours, depending on the size and number of slabs involved.

Can concrete raising prevent further damage? Properly performed concrete raising can help prevent additional settling or cracking, but ongoing maintenance may be necessary.
